Inspired by the trailer (and awesome trailer song) of the new Evangelion film my brother and I decided to watch the Rebuild films this week, having only seen the series before.

1 was good and the Gun Battle ending was great.

2 though was really fantastic. Everything I could want out of an anime movie, really. The pacing was punchy, the character development was charming and involving, and some of the action was Make You Want To Go Straight To The Gym visceral. And when That music kicked in during the berserk scene at the end I nearly exploded. Such a beaut, looking forward to the next two.

My only real qualm is the new artstyle which is far more generic for the characters than the brilliantly old-school sharp chins and nose style of the series. They all look a bit Beyblade and glossy.

But this is outweighed by how entertaining the second film is in every other way.
